20.5 CONCLUSION
(1) The method of acceleration of plant breeding process offers at sprouting of
mature seed in inflorescences of cereal cultures, ears of grain growing, and
panicles of millet. A method plugs the soakage of inflorescences in PABA
(concentrations of 0.1% and 0.2%) dissolved in an acetic acid.
(2) Dissolution of PABA in an acetic acid is more effective, than dissolution in hot
water (control II). Activating of phenotype at soakage in PABA, dissolved in
an acetic acid, in variants (3-5) was higher than in control II - at soakage in
PABA dissolved in hot water.
(3) Soakage of inflorescences during 3-4 hr in PABA a dissolved in an acetic acid,
gives the best result. More protracted soakage - 5-6 hr some reduces by all
variants.
(4) Concentrations of PABA applied to the treating of inflorescences were higher
than in the cited works in which treated trashed seeds.
